Statement of Direction: Oracle Forms, Oracle

Good news for all Forms & Reports users: There will be 12c versions. Migration path is clear. But there is no need to hurry at the moment. Maybe we talk about strategic options for the future?

 

Oracle says:

Oracle remains committed to the support of Oracle Forms and Reports. The support cycle is

aligned to Oracle Fusion Middleware 11g for Forms and Reports and Oracle Developer Suite 10g

for Oracle Designer. This continuation of support will allow customers to easily upgrade their

applications to the web and benefit from the centralized deployment and shared services that the

application server provides.

Given the rapid growth and adoption of Java/Java EE technologies in the industry, Oracle’s

strategy is also to provide a productive Java EE development environment (JDeveloper, Oracle

ADF, and BI Publisher) allowing Forms, Reports and Designer customers to embrace Java EE

development while still using a familiar RAD, visual and declarative approach. 

Oracle recommends customers to web-deploy their existing Forms and Reports applications,

consider the opportunities of new development in Java EE using JDeveloper, Oracle ADF, and

BI Publisher, and integrate these applications together on Oracle Fusion Middleware, sharing

common services and business logic. 

With this strategy, Oracle allows customers to continue to leverage their existing investments for

many years while offering a path to incrementally move to Java EE, at their own pace, using a

productive and familiar development environment: JDeveloper and ADF, and BI Publisher.
